Abstract

Present options for the management of urethral erosion following transvaginal mesh sling placement. Urethral erosions following transvaginal mesh sling placement has been reported as a rare complication. We present the surgical options for the treatment of this complication from the minimally invasive option of holmium laser ablation at the time of cystourethroscopy to transvaginal excision of the mesh erosion with labial fat pad interposition. This video highlights the surgical options for the treatment of urethral mesh erosion following a transvaginal mesh sling placement.
